Next on 'Capitaland Quarterly:' The Economics of Integrity


Anna Bernasek'Capitaland Quarterly' offers an in-depth look at issues related to business, employment, development and living in New York's Capital Region. A joint project of WMHT and the Times Union, 'Capitaland Quarterly' consists of both a quarterly magazine published by the Times Union, as well as a corresponding television program produced by WMHT. For recent 'Capitaland Quarterly' articles and resources, visit the publication.

The next edition of 'Capitaland Quarterly' will air on WMHT on Thursday, April 1, 2010 at 9 p.m. and Sunday, April 4 at 10 a.m., and will feature Anna Bernasek, the author of 'The Economics of Integrity: From Dairy Farmers to Toyota, How Wealth is Built on Trust and What That Means for Our Future.' Filled with a wealth of details, Bernasek's book moves away from the coverage of what went wrong in 2008 and focuses instead on what has worked and why.
